Use mild, phosphate-free detergent without bleach, fabric softeners, or optical brighteners.
Wash in cold or warm water (max 60°C/140°F); avoid overloading the machine.
Tumble dry on low heat or air-dry; avoid overdrying to protect the flame-retardant coating.
Iron on low heat without steam to prevent damage to the flame-resistant treatment.
Avoid fabric softeners, scent sprays, oils, and any chemicals that can potentially degrade flame-retardant properties.
Inspect regularly for wear and tear and replace bedding if it no longer meets safety standards.
Store in a cool, dry place using breathable bags; avoid using plastic for storage.
